===Backstory and Queue===The Kali River Rapids is set inside the fictional Anandapur Township which lies on the Chakranadi Riverhttp://www. Signs throughout Anandapur warn that illegal loggers are damaging the environment with slash and burn logging techniques. Because of these environmental concerns, Manisha Gurung, a local woman started the Kali Rapids Expeditions. Manisha's goal by starting the attraction was to show that there were more ecofriendly ways of creating income for the village. The entrance to the Kali River Rapids is located just next to the home of its owner Manisha Guring. After passing by the house, guests follow a path surrounded by bamboo. After strolling by many eroding religious artifacts, guests enter the Tiger Temple. Here, guests see a wall covered with ribbon, as well as bells hanging from the rafters. Each ribbon on the wall represents a prayer made, whereas each bell represents a prayer answered. As guests enter the temple, they may notice that there does not seem to be any particular religion evoked. Instead, Imagineers designed the temple to honor wildlife and animals instead of a particular deity. Throughout the temple, guests can see various religious artifacts and even a large tiger statue. Before venturing deeper into the temple; guests enter a room which holds statues of King Cobras. After passing through the Painted Pavilion, guests exit the Tiger Temple and enter Mr. Panika's Shop which is located directly adjacent to the building. Inside the shop, guests can browse through Mr. Panika's huge inventory of (mostly animal) related merchandise. Signs throughout the shop suggest that Mr. Panika is fairly desperate to make sales. Next the store, guests can see a small bird market, which doesn't have any real birds in it. Across from the market sits and uninhabited aviary.After meandering their way through the shop, guests finally enter the Kali Rapids Expeditions. On the overhead speakers, they can hear Manisha Gurung explain why she started her business. The office itself is littered with old appliances such as a telephone, typewriter, answering machine and film cameras. A slide projector in the room also gives guests a glimpse of the some of the sights that they will see on the rapids. Inside the office, guests can also find a map of Anandapur and a raft position chart. As guests enter the second room of the office, they hear someone over the radio warn Manisha that illegal logging his taking place along the river, and that the raft rides should stop. Unfortunately, since Manisha is nowhere to be found, the rafting expeditions continue on. Inside this room, guests can also see stylized painting so many of the scenes that they will soon see on the Kali River Rapids.===Main Ride===After making their way through the queue, guests load into large 12 seat rafts. As the raft leaves the dock, it begins to go up a incline. On either side of the river, stone animal guardians gaze upon guests as they ascend. When guests reach the area on top of the incline (known as Tiger Bay), geysers begin to erupt all around them before the river takes a 90 degree turn and winds in to a forest. While the forest at first seems peaceful, guests soon find themselves passing by an illegal logging operation. Here, guests both hear and smell the forest burning around them, as piles of wood burn on the banks. Across the river, guests also see one of the logging trucks sliding down the bank and into the river. After passing by the loggers, guests begin to plummet down a 30 foot waterfall. After surviving the fall, guests continue their tour through the tranquil forest. Guests then pass through a small cave, where the statues of three gods fill the river with water from their pots. As guests pass by the gods, they are splashed with the water coming from the jugs. Due to the Chakrandi's circular nature, guests find themselves back at the Tiger Temple. Before reaching the dock, guests past beneath a bridge, where two stone elephants shoot water onto the raft. The elephants are actually controlled by guests pushing a button on the bridge.
